AWS Device Farm is a cloud-based mobile app testing service offered by Amazon Web Services (AWS). It provides a platform for developers to test and interact with their Android, iOS, and web applications on real devices in the AWS cloud. By utilizing AWS Device Farm, developers can run automated tests to ensure the quality and functionality of their mobile apps across a wide range of devices without the need to manage physical devices themselves.
In the realm of Load and Performance Testing, AWS Device Farm falls under the category of mobile app testing solutions. It allows developers to execute a variety of tests, including performance testing, compatibility testing, and exploratory tests, to identify and rectify any issues that may affect the user experience of their applications. By offering a diverse set of testing capabilities, AWS Device Farm empowers developers to deliver high-performing, bug-free mobile apps to their users.
AWS Device Farm was founded in 2015 by Amazon Web Services. The motivation behind its creation was to address the growing complexity and challenges associated with mobile app testing. With the proliferation of mobile devices and operating system versions, developers needed a reliable and scalable solution to ensure their apps function seamlessly across various platforms. AWS Device Farm emerged as a response to this need, providing a cloud-based testing platform that simplifies and streamlines the testing process for mobile app developers.
